Frequently Asked Questions about Sheldonville
How much are Studio apartments in Sheldonville?
There are currently 8 Studio Apartments in Sheldonville with rent ranges from $1,490 to $2,350 with an average price of $1,837.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Sheldonville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Sheldonville ranges from $1,630 to $7,508 with an average monthly rent of $2,264.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Sheldonville c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Sheldonville range from $1,895 to $8,014.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,789.
How expensive are Sheldonville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 13 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Sheldonville on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,929 to $15,742 - averaging $3,544 for the location.
